### Waveform previews

The `/previews/waveform` endpoint on Soundloft renders a peaks array for any uploaded clip — handy for the scrubber UI, cheap to call. It's internal-only, so requests need a service key rather than user tokens. Reviewers testing locally should hit the staging cluster with the key below.

service key, fawip-bajef: kto11_Qt5wZK9vdNC

Team — digest scheduler for Mailbraid batch sends is now cron-driven, not queue-polled. Future maintainers: the hourly window logic lives in the scheduler module, nowhere else. Don't reintroduce polling; it caused the Delvern duplicate-send incident. Staging verified, prod rollout tomorrow. Rollback is a config flip. The build token for this release is directly below.

pipeline stamp: htk9_ce63042d9

Hey team — quick note on the Brindlewood pool changes before this merges. We bumped the connection pool so the Orchave sync jobs stop starving the support dashboard during peak hours. If customers report slow lookups again, check pool exhaustion first, not the query layer. Nothing else changed in this PR. The constants we settled on are listed below.

tuning constants:
QUOTAS = {
    "druwyn": 5,
    "holix": 5,
    "zorath": 5,
    "holwyn": 10,
}

## Zero-downtime schema migrations

At Quillbrook we never ship a migration and its dependent code in the same deploy. Reviewers should confirm each change follows the expand–migrate–contract sequence: add the new column or table, backfill in batches behind a flag, switch reads, then drop the old structure in a later release. Reject any pull request that renames a column in place, however small it looks. The full checklist, including backfill batch-size guidance, lives on the page below.

runbook for tajep-yahig: https://artifactory.lumictech.corp/repo

Runbook: DocSweep linter stuck? Usually it's a stale rules cache — clear it and re-run. Heads up for security review: the linter reads draft docs, so its logs can contain unpublished text; they're retained for 24h only on the Bramleigh box. If it still hangs, grab the trace token printed below.

pipeline stamp: htk3_a71